Baking vs Roasting

  • Baking Squash- Baking vegetables requires alower temperatureand longercooking time. When squash is baked, it softens and cooks throughout. The texture remains soft without caramelization because the squash still retains moisture.
  • Roasting Squash- Roasting vegetables requires a high-temperature oven, usually between 400 to 450degrees f. When roasted, squash remains soft and creamy internally, but the exterior becomes crispy and caramelized.

Is it better to bake orroast butternutsquash?The answer to this question depends on personal preference and the texture you seek. That said, roasting butternut squash is the more common preparation process.

Step-By-Step Instructions

How To Roast Frozen Butternut Squash (Oven Recipe) (3)
How To Roast Frozen Butternut Squash (Oven Recipe) (4)
  1. Preheat the oven to 425degrees F.
  2. In alarge bowlor on abaking sheet, toss thefrozen butternutsquashcubesinolive oil, salt, andblack pepperto coat.
  3. Arrange thesquash cubesin asingle layeron a large non-stick orparchment paper-linedsheet pan.
  4. Roast, turning them halfway through, for 40-45 minutes until they are lightlygolden brownon the outside and soft on the inside. **Cooking times will vary depending on the size of the butternutsquash cubes.

CookingSquash Cubesin the Air Fryer

While roasting squash is thebest wayto cook it. You can achieve a similar cook using an air fryer. Air frying is an alternativecooking methodto achieve agolden brown, crispy exterior, and creamy interior.

  1. Preheat the air fryer to 400degrees F.
  2. Toss thefrozen butternutsquashcubesinolive oiland seasonings.
  3. Place thesquash cubesin theair fryer basketin asingle layer. Cook for 15 - 20 minutes, depending on the size of the squash, tossing the squash halfway through the cooking process.

**Cooking times will vary depending on the size of the butternutsquash cubes. Cook1-inch cubesfor approximately 20 minutes. Air fry 1-inch or smaller cubes for approximately 15 minutes.

Variations

  • Maple Cinnamon: Omit theblack pepper. In addition to theolive oiland salt, toss the squash in 1 tablespoon of puremaple syrupand ½ teaspoon of ground cinnamon.
  • Garlic: Add ½ teaspoon ofgarlic powderalongside the salt and pepper.
  • Rosemary: Add 1 tablespoon of chopped fresh rosemary when seasoning and oiling thesquash cubes.

Storage

Store cooled, roasted butternut squash in anairtight containerin the refrigerator for 4-5 days.

To Reheat: Cook leftover squash in a 350degrees Foven (or air fryer) until heated through.

Expert Tips

  1. Do Not Thaw- Roast frozen vegetables straight from the freezer (from frozen); do not thaw them. As vegetables thaw, they release moisture.
  2. High Heat- Roast vegetables at ahigh temperatureto achieve a caramelized, crispy exterior and soft interior.
  3. Do Not Overcrowd- Place the butternut squash on thebaking sheetin aneven layerwithout overlap.
  4. Cooking Time- Everyfrozen vegetablebrand is different. Theroasting timewill vary depending on the size of thesquash cubes.

Frequently Asked Questions

Where do you buyfrozen squash?

Many, but not all,grocery stores carry butternut squash in the freezer section. It comes already peeled and cut into cubes. The size of the cubes will vary depending on the brand.

Can you freeze roasted squash?

While roasted vegetables are best eaten fresh, you can freeze them. Place cooled, roastedsquash cubes on a sheet tray and freeze until frozen through. Transfer the frozen cubes to a freeze bag orfreezer-safe container. Freeze for up to 3 months. Cook from frozen or thaw it in the refrigerator and reheat.

Is butternut squash healthy?

Roasted squash is a nutrient-dense, low-calorie side dish that contains ant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als. It contains healthy amounts of vitamin A, vitamin C, magnesium, and potassium.

Ingredients

  • 16 oz frozen butternut squash cubes
  • tablespoon olive oil
  • ½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 425°F.

  • In a bowl or on abaking sheet, toss thefrozen butternutsquashcubesinolive oil, salt, andblack pepperto coat.

  • Arrange thesquash cubesin asingle layeron a large non-stick orparchment paper-linedbaking sheet.

  • Roast, turning them halfway through, for 40-45 minutes until they are lightlygolden brownon the outside and soft on the inside.**Cooking times will vary depending on the size of the butternutsquash cubes.
